The Serie B meeting at Stadio Libero Liberati on Saturday sees home side Ternana lock horns with Ascoli, and we have the latest injury news and predicted line ups to hand.
Ternana enter this fixture after a 0-0 Serie B drawn match against Brescia. It looks as if Ternana may well kick off with a 3-5-1-1 formation for this game, handing starts to Tommaso Vitali, Christian Dalle Mura, Marco Capuano, Lorenzo Lucchesi, Tiago Casasola, Gregorio Luperini, Lorenzo Amatucci, Kees de Boer, Franco Carboni, Gaston Pereiro and Antonio Raimondo.
Ternana boss Roberto Breda has a full complement, with no fitness concerns to speak of before this match owing to a fully injury-free group to choose from.

Previously, Ascoli drew 0-0 in the Serie B tie with Modena. We’re of the thinking that Bianconeri will likely play in a 3-5-2 system by sending out Devis Vásquez, Sauli Vaisanen, Valerio Mantovani, Danilo Quaranta, Marcello Falzerano, Patrizio Masini, Samuel Giovane, Francesco Di Tacchio, Karim Zedadka, Ilija Nestorovski and Pablo Rodríguez.
Ascoli manager Massimo Carrera has not got a full squad to pick from. Luka Bogdan (Knee surgery), Riccardo Gagliolo (Calf problems), Erdis Kraja (Cruciate ligament tear), Brian Bayeye (Hamstring injury) and Pedro Mendes (Hamstring injury) miss out here.
